Skills and Experience to Highlight:
- Voice Technology Proficiency: Demonstrable experience with major voice platforms and systems, including the ability to write test scopes and test cases.
- Technical Skills: Expertise in areas such as VoIP (SIP & RTP), voice quality testing techniques (objective/subjective), echo control, voice band data (modems including DTMF), and fax testing methods.
- Standards Knowledge: Familiarity with voice codecs and relevant standards like ITU-T, NICC, and Openreach SIN.
- Tooling Experience: Experience with systems such as Nokia HDMo Empirix SVM, Opale Multi-DSLA, QualityLogic FaxLab, JIRA/Xray, and Amazon Web Services (Logs Insights).
- Programming & Scripting: Proficiency in modern programming languages and frameworks is advantageous. Scripting skills, particularly in Python, are highly desired for automation enhancement.
- CI/CD & Cloud: Experience with CI/CD pipelines, and knowledge of cloud computing, microservices architecture, and containerization are preferred.
- Data Analysis & Problem Solving: Experience in driving performance and process improvements through data analysis and structured problem-solving is a strong asset.
- Stakeholder Management: Ability to own relationships at an operational level and articulate complex technical issues to senior management.
